William Saliba injury news: France, Arsenal defender subbed off in World Cup semifinal
France and Arsenal defender William Saliba was subbed off with an apparent hamstring injury after 30 minutes of Les Bleus' 2026 World Cup semifinal against Spain on Tuesday.
MORE — France vs Spain live blog
Saliba was casually jogging back into his own half with the ball when he pulled up lame and immediately took a seat on the ground, appearing to reach for the back of his left leg. He was replaced by Crystal Palace center back Maxence Lacroix.
The 25-year-old has been nearly ever-present for Arsenal since breaking into the first team during the 2022-23 season. He appeared in 43 games and played more than 3,700 minutes between the Premier League and Champions League this season, winning the former and finishing runners-up to PSG for the latter.
